Steering Column Removal and Installation

1. Disconnect battery ground cable, then place front wheels in straight ahead position.
2. Remove fuse panel cover from left end of instrument panel, then remove instrument panel cover mounting screw from behind fuse panel.
3. Remove center bezel from top cover of instrument panel, then remove top cover of instrument panel.
4. Remove knee bolster.
5. Remove two air bag module Torx head mounting bolts from steering wheel, then remove air bag.
6. Disconnect clockspring electrical connection from air bag module.
7. Remove speed control switches from steering wheel, then disconnect clockspring and horn ground wire.
8. Remove steering wheel retaining nut from steering column shaft, then remove steering wheel using puller tool No. CJ2001P, or equivalent.
9. Remove upper shroud from steering column then tilt column to its highest position and remove lower shroud.

10. Remove wiring harness connectors from clockspring, halo light and ignition switch.
11. On models equipped with automatic transmission, place key cylinder in Off position, then remove shifter/ignition interlock cable from key lock housing.
12. On all models, remove pinch bolt from steering coupler, then separate steering coupler from steering gear.
13. Ensure steering column tilt lever is in locked position, then insert a 7/32 drill bit in each locking pin hole on upper steering column bracket.
14. Remove upper steering column support bracket mounting nuts, then remove lower steering column support bracket mounting nuts.
15. Remove steering column assembly.
16. Reverse procedure to install, noting the following:
a. Depress two clockspring locking pins to disengage clockspring locking mechanism.
b. With clockspring locking mechanism disengaged, rotate clockspring rotor fully clockwise until does not turn. Do not apply excessive torque.
c. Rotate clockspring rotor counterclockwise until yellow appears in clockspring centering window.
d. Engage clockspring locking mechanism.
